Today travelblog.org hosted it's 200,000th blog entry. Here it is:

Travelblog quietly passed it's 5th birthday, April 5th 2002 was the date of the first post... some drivel about my last day of work before what I thought would be a one year travel experience.
Travelblog.org is the second largest travel community on the internet (source alexa.com) - only virtual tourist has more activity. Also according to alexa travelblog.org is the 3,700th (ish) most popular site in Australia, 6,400th (ish) most popular in the UK - and up there in many other countries.
